Cast light weight aluminum alloys are made by melting pure aluminum and integrating it with various other metals while in liquid form. The mix is poured into a sand, pass away, or investment mold. After solidification, the metal is eliminated from its mold and mildew. At this phase, it remains in either its final form or as a billet or ingot for additional processing.

There are numerous minor differences between wrought and cast aluminum alloys, such as that cast alloys can include more considerable amounts of various other steels than functioned alloys. The most notable difference in between these alloys is the fabrication procedure with which they will certainly go to deliver the last item. In addition to some surface treatments, cast alloys will exit their mold and mildew in virtually the exact strong form preferred, whereas wrought alloys will certainly undergo numerous alterations while in their strong state

Various parts need various manufacturing strategies to cast light weight aluminum, such as sand casting or pass away casting.
Die spreading is the name provided to the process of producing complicated metal elements through usage of molds of the part, likewise referred to as passes away. The procedure makes use of non-ferrous metals which do not include iron, such as light weight aluminum, zinc and magnesium, due to the preferable buildings of the steels such as low weight, higher conductivity, non-magnetic conductivity and resistance to deterioration.
Pass away casting production is quick, making high manufacturing levels of elements simple. It produces even more parts than any type of various other procedure, with a high level of precision and repeatability. For more information concerning die spreading and pass away spreading products made use of in the procedure, checked out on. There are 3 sub-processes that drop under the group of die casting: gravity pass away casting (or irreversible mold spreading), low-pressure die casting and high-pressure die spreading.

To reach the completed product, there are 3 key alloys used as die casting product to select from: zinc, light weight aluminum and magnesium.
Zinc is among the most previously owned alloys for die casting due to its reduced price of basic materials. It's likewise one of the more powerful and stable metals. And also, it has exceptional electric and thermal conductivity. Its corrosion resistance likewise permits the components to be lengthy long-term, and it is one of the extra castable alloys as a result of its reduced melting factor.
